While from a dog's perspective a vacuum already looks odd enough, add on top of that the high-frequency shrieks it emits, which can be quite painful to his ears. WebMar 13, 2024 · The main reason why dogs are scared of vacuums is because of the loud noise that vacuums make. Dogs’ ears are a lot more sensitive compared to our (human) ears. Just like with thunderstorms, many dogs’ fear of vacuums stems from the loud, high-frequency noises the machine makes. The goal of vacuum training is to help change your dog’s perception of the vacuum, taking it from nemesis to occasional nuisance.
